#de53bb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#de53bb is composed of 87.1% red, 32.5% green and 73.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 62.6% magenta, 15.8% yellow and 12.9% black. It has a hue angle of 315.1 degrees, a saturation of 67.8% and a lightness of 59.8%. #de53bb color hex could be obtained by blending #ffa6ff with #bd0077. Closest websafe color is: #cc66cc.

#de53bb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#de53bb has RGB values of R:222, G:83, B:187 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.63, Y:0.16,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 14570427.

Hex triplet de53bb #de53bb
RGB Decimal 222, 83, 187 rgb(222,83,187)
RGB Percent 87.1, 32.5, 73.3 rgb(87.1%,32.5%,73.3%)
CMYK 0, 63, 16, 13
HSL 315.1°, 67.8, 59.8 hsl(315.1,67.8%,59.8%)
HSV (or HSB) 315.1°, 62.6, 87.1
Web Safe cc66cc #cc66cc
CIE-LAB 57.373, 65.138, -27.458
XYZ 42.187, 25.307, 49.674
xyY 0.36, 0.216, 25.307
CIE-LCH 57.373, 70.689, 337.143
CIE-LUV 57.373, 72.935, -51.704
Hunter-Lab 50.306, 61.655, -23.331
Binary 11011110, 01010011, 10111011

Shades and Tints of #de53bb

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090207 is the darkest color, while #fef8f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#de53bb

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9f929c is the less saturated color, while #fe33cb is the most saturated one.
